DAKA — Saudi Deputy Foreign Minister Eng. Waleed El-Khereiji met on Wednesday with Bangladesh's Foreign Affairs Adviser Dr. Khalilur Rahman and Home Affairs Adviser Salahuddin Ahmed to discuss ways to strengthen bilateral relations across various fields.
During the meeting, held at Bangladesh's Ministry of Foreign Affairs, the officials also explored ways to enhance bilateral coordination on issues of mutual interest to the two brotherly countries.
The meeting was attended by Advisor at the Office of the Minister of Interior Lt. Gen. Suleiman bin Abdulaziz Al-Yahya,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s for Consular Affairs Ambassador Dr. Mohammed Al-Shammari, Deputy Minister of Human Resources and Social Development for Labor Market Policies Muhannad Al-Essa, and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ques' Ambassador to Bangladesh Essa bin Yousef Al-Duhailan.
